How much do litigation funding jobs pay per year?
What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in litigation funding, and why are they important?
To thrive in Litigation Funding, you need a strong background in law or finance, commercial litigation experience, and robust analytical skills. Familiarity with legal research databases, case management systems, and financial modeling tools is highly valuable in this field. Exceptional negotiation, risk assessment, and communication abilities help professionals excel in evaluating and structuring funding deals. These competencies are crucial for accurately assessing cases, building client relationships, and supporting the successful funding and resolution of complex legal disputes.
What are some typical challenges faced by professionals in litigation funding?
Professionals in litigation funding often encounter challenges such as accurately assessing the merits and risks of complex legal cases and navigating uncertain outcomes. Balancing the needs of claimants, legal teams, and investors requires strong analytical and interpersonal skills. Additionally, there can be significant pressure to meet deal flow targets while ensuring due diligence and risk management are not compromised. Working in this field offers exposure to a dynamic environment, with each case presenting unique legal and commercial considerations, making adaptability and continuous learning essential for long-term success.
What does a litigation funding job involve?
A Litigation Funding job involves assessing legal claims to determine investment potential, providing financial support to litigants or law firms in exchange for a portion of potential settlements or judgments. Professionals in this field analyze case merits, manage risk, and negotiate funding agreements. They work closely with attorneys, financial analysts, and investors to structure deals that maximize returns while ensuring ethical and legal compliance.
